Koori (or Koorie) Koori is a term denoting an Aboriginal person of southern New South Wales or Victoria. ‘Koori’ is not a synonym for ‘Aboriginal’. There are many other Aboriginal groups across Australia (such as Murri, Noongar, Yolngu) with which Indigenous Australians may identify themselves. What Is Victoria’S Secret Meaning?
Founded in 1977 and named after Queen Victoria, for an association with the refinement of the Victorian era, the “secret” being the body concealed by the clothing. What Did Victorians Smell Like?
Scents popular at this time were light and floral. Flowers were some of the most popular ingredients, with thyme, rosemary, and clove also often added. What did Victorian men smell like? Are There Big Cats In Victoria?
The report. Witness sightings have been recorded, over at least 60 years, of cougars, panthers or pumas in a wide stretch of Victoria from Gippsland to the Otways, the Grampians, central Victoria and at Beechworth in the northeast.
